Overslaan en naar de inhoud gaan

Ook Linux bant 'master' en 'slave'

Linux-vader Linus Torvalds is akkoord met het voorstel om neutrale termen te gebruiken in de kernelcode en documentatie. Hij heeft zijn goedkeuring gegeven aan een voorstel dat alternatieven voorstelt voor de termen master/slave en blacklist/whitelist.
Linus
© TED
TED

Zo worden onder andere als alternatief voor master/slave voorgesteld: primary/secondary, main/replica of subordinate of initiator/target. Voor blacklist/whitelist zijn de voorstellen denylist/allowlist of blocklist/passlist. Het team geeft geen voorkeuren voor een van de alternatieve termen en zegt dat ontwikkelaars zelf kunnen kiezen.

Nieuwe termen

In nieuwe code die wordt geschreven voor de Linux-kernel en bijhorende documentatie zullen de nieuwe termen worden gebruikt. De oude termen mogen alleen nog worden gebruikt bij het onderhouden van oudere code en documentatie of “bij het updaten van code voor een bestaande (vanaf 2020) hardware- of protocolspecificatie die deze voorwaarden verplicht stelt.”

Steeds meer ontwikkelaars verzetten zich tegen het gebruik van termen die door delen van de bevolking als kwetsend worden ervaren. Zo deden Python en GitHub ook al de termen ‘master’ en ‘slave’ in de ban.

Reacties

Om een reactie achter te laten is een account vereist.

Inloggen Word abonnee

Bevestig jouw e-mailadres

We hebben de bevestigingsmail naar %email% gestuurd.

Geen bevestigingsmail ontvangen? Controleer je spam folder. Niet in de spam, klik dan hier om een account aan te maken.

Er is iets mis gegaan

Helaas konden we op dit moment geen account voor je aanmaken. Probeer het later nog eens.

Maak een gratis account aan en geniet van alle voordelen:

Heb je al een account? Log in

Maak een gratis account aan en geniet van alle voordelen:

Heb je al een account? Log in